pampo Posted September 20, 2011 Share Posted September 20, 2011 Ciao a tutti, sono nuovo di prestashop e ho una domanda semplice da fare. Vorrei solamente aggiungere un div che contenga il #page per potergli mettere uno sfondo diverso. Il problema è che io inserisco quest div nel file header.tpl, lo chiudo nel file footer.tpl, metto le regole css in global.css e quando carico il tutto non mi appaiono le modifiche. Come mai? Inoltre se da chrome guarda il codice sorgente quel div semplicemente è come se non esistesse. Qualcuno sa aiutarmi? dove sbaglio? Link to comment Share on other sites More sharing options...
assisassi Posted September 21, 2011 Share Posted September 21, 2011 Credo che il problema sia nella cache che PS usa per velocizzare il caricamento pagine. Ma se modifichi qualcosa devi disattivarla altrimenti carica sempre i vecchi valori. Nella scheda preferenze>performance puoi modificare questi parametri. In pratica, facendo modifiche, devi: nella Smarty: Obbliga la compilazione: si Conserva la classe Blowfish: no nella CCC: Mantieni il funzionamento classico nelle prime due Smart cache e in fondo disattiva Utilizza la cache. Vedrai che nella 'ispeziona elemento' di Crome i css faranno riferimento ai rispettivi file css e non a file da lunghi nomi alfanumerici, presenti in cartelle /cache/. Penso che le tue modifiche ora si vedranno. Ciao Link to comment Share on other sites More sharing options...
IlTuoAmicoWM Posted September 22, 2011 Share Posted September 22, 2011 Ciao, mi permetto di suggerirti una cosa, quando fai questi cambiamenti, è utile "duplicare" il template originale, attivandolo poi da BO. Tutte le tue modifiche vai a farle sul template duplicato, in maniera che ti rimane sempre l'originale. Quando tocchi i file tpl, poi nella cartella tools-smarty-compile elimina tutti i file tranne index. Salvo errori nelle modifiche da te fatte, così da FE aggiorni e vedi le modifiche. Link to comment Share on other sites More sharing options...
pampo Posted September 27, 2011 Author Share Posted September 27, 2011 Credo che il problema sia nella cache che PS usa per velocizzare il caricamento pagine. Ma se modifichi qualcosa devi disattivarla altrimenti carica sempre i vecchi valori. Nella scheda preferenze>performance puoi modificare questi parametri. In pratica, facendo modifiche, devi: nella Smarty: Obbliga la compilazione: si Conserva la classe Blowfish: no nella CCC: Mantieni il funzionamento classico nelle prime due Smart cache e in fondo disattiva Utilizza la cache. Vedrai che nella 'ispeziona elemento' di Crome i css faranno riferimento ai rispettivi file css e non a file da lunghi nomi alfanumerici, presenti in cartelle /cache/. Penso che le tue modifiche ora si vedranno. Ciao grazie mille era proprio quello il problema. Ora riesco a modificare il template come voglio Link to comment Share on other sites More sharing options...
Recommended Posts
Create an account or sign in to comment
You need to be a member in order to leave a comment
Create an account
Sign up for a new account in our community. It's easy!
Register a new accountSign in
Already have an account? Sign in here.
Sign In Now